    <![CDATA[<strong>Author:</strong> <a href="https://forum.asrock.com/member_profile.asp?PF=24360">threadzipper1957</a><br /><strong>Subject:</strong> 19398<br /><strong>Posted:</strong> 15 Mar 2022 at 5:17pm<br /><br />Hello,<br /><br />The latest BIOS is not always the best, in this case 7.60, will patch the <br />Spectre Meltdown bug, which affected Both Intel and AMD.<br />Your board has 2 BIOS chips, I don't know which version is on the other chip, but by flipping the switch before you start, it will boot from the other chip.<br />If the problem is related to the BIOS version, you could downgrade the BIOS.<br />First check, if the second BIOS chip is working, if not, boot from the first chip, go into BIOS&gt;&gt; Tools, and run Secure backup UEFI, this will flash the other chip, with the same version that is active.<br />Then test by starting from the second chip, if this works, you can downgrade the BIOS (always use Instant flash, NOT the Windows flash)<br />There will not be any further BIOS development since the product is EOL,. since 5 years.<br />You can also buy the 128Mb BIOS chip online, preprogrammed<br /><a href="https://www.biosflash.com/index.htm" target="_blank" rel="nofollow">https://www.biosflash.com/index.htm</a><br /><br />]]>

    <![CDATA[<strong>Author:</strong> <a href="https://forum.asrock.com/member_profile.asp?PF=21264">RiskyFuture</a><br /><strong>Subject:</strong> 19398<br /><strong>Posted:</strong> 13 Aug 2021 at 9:24am<br /><br />Hi there<br />I have a Z170 oc formula loaded with a 6600k, when I purchased the board (second hand / used) it had the 2.40 bios and on my oc formula drive I had the autotune feature avalible in the software, after updating to the latest bios I have lost the ability to Autotune in oc formula drive.<br />Is there a setting in the bios that I am missing to enable that feature or is it something like one of the switches on the motherboard that enables this feature as when i had purchased it the LN2 switch was enabled or is it a combo of both bios and switches.<br />I would like this feature back any help would be great.<br />Cheers, Shane]]>
